About This Dog for Adoption

Angel's ideal home

Angel can be shy around men, but she settles quickly after a couple of meetings. She could live with children aged 14 and over. She doesn't appreciate much interaction with other dogs therefore we would recommend her being the only dog in the home. Angel is house trained and can be left for a couple of hours during the day once she is settled in. We recommend having a few meets with Angel to build up that bond before taking her home. We have sought expert advice and do not believe Angel to be XL Bully type.

Could you be Angel's perfect match?

8 year old Angel is a shy girl who lacks confidence with new people but loves hard when she knows you. She's always always excited to her favourite people and will smother them with kisses and white hairs! She loves to sit and snuggle and will happily let her carers sit on her bed with her, gently stroking her ears and rubbing her chest. Angel arrived in March 2022 and in January this year we managed to find her a foster home. She has settled very well and has been very affectionate with her foster family, and loves to curl up on the sofa. Angel is sometimes unsure about men but bonded with her male foster carer very quickly. If introduced slowly, she is much less apprehensive. She is polite around food and clean in the home, and has never been destructive. Angel was a little unsettled for the first couple of days in her new environment, but now likes to sit and watch out of the window, and she is a different dog than we've seen in kennels. She's much more relaxed and laid back and likes to snooze on the sofa and have occasional zoomies. She gains in confidence every day, but is still walked at quiet times so she can adjust to things gradually as she is easily spooked by noises. If allowed time to settle, she is going to make someone a wonderful companion, and they'll love her as much as we do.

American Bully Puppy Buying Checklist

We highly recommend every buyer reads through the below advice when purchasing or rehoming a American Bulldog.

  • View the animal in the place it was born and raised - check for genuine home environments if buying privately, or the quality of the breeders set-up if applicable.
  • If viewing a puppy under 8 weeks, by law they MUST be seen with their mum.
  • Make sure the animal's old enough to be rehomed. 8 weeks should be the earliest a puppy can be rehomed.
  • By law, all dogs MUST be microchipped
  • Review and verify any documents, such as KC registration paperwork where applicable

Avoid Potential Scams

There are a number of red flags to look out for when purchasing a new puppy:

  • Seller demands a deposit without allowing you to see the dog first - never send any money before meeting the animal in person
  • Seller is reluctant to send you additional photos or videos
  • Seller offers to deliver the dog/puppy
  • Seller asks to meet in a mutual location
  • Seller uses fake or stolen photos from the internet. Always carry out a "Google image search".
  • Seller asks to immediately switch to communication off the American Bully Owners website
  • Seller uses a different phone number to the one listed on the website - especially if that phone number is in one of the advert images
